Thoughts on England-Norway…
*Bellingham is a bizarre player… you rarely feel his presence, until he pops up for the decisive moment, which he does with crazy consistency and regularity. A Heroic Moments merchant (compliment).
*Odegaard makes the right play every time, perfect blend of risk/threat and control.
*Saka total game changer. Gave England a (previously absent) coherent theory of attack - get the ball to Bukayo, have him draw two, and work from there. Like watching SGA in iso.
*Elliot Anderson is worth the $153 million. Ridiculous touch, control, passing range, composure, grit. The cross field driven lofts are inch perfect. Best player on the pitch.
*Tuchel was right - England were pretty poor overall, 7 shots and 0.31 xG in regulation was very meek, but it was largely because of him. Eze over Rogers made no sense - Arsenal are literally trying to sign Rogers because he’s better than Eze. Tuchel changed the defensive and midfield balance so frequently that no one had any rhythm or continuity. Finally got it right with the last two subs - Rogers and Spence gave the team the right balance.
